Geographic Location of Sinapali


The village Sinapali is located in Kegaon Police Station Jurisdiction of Kalahandi District in the State of Odisha in India. It is governed by Sinapali Gram Panchayat. It comes under Golamunda Community Development Block. The nearest town is Khariar Road, which is about 20 kilometers away from Sinapali.

Social Structure of Sinapali


As per available data from the year 2009, 1494 persons live in 395 house holds in the village Sinapali. There are 744 female individuals and 750 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 49.8% and males constitute 50.2% of the total population.

There are 390 scheduled castes persons of which 201 are females and 189 are males. Females constitute 51.54% and males constitute 48.46%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 26.1% of the total population.

There are 265 scheduled tribes persons of which 134 are females and 131 are males. Females constitute 50.57% and males constitute 49.43%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 17.74% of the total population.

Population density of Sinapali is 416.16 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Sinapali

Total area of Sinapali is 359 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 179.48 ha. About 179.48 ha is un-irrigated area.

About 17.49 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 8.73 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 0.04 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 145.86 ha is culturable waste land.

Schools in Sinapali


There are no pre-primary schools in the village Sinapali or anywhere in the nearby villages.

There is a government primary school in the village Sinapali.

There is a government middle school in the village Sinapali.

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private secondary school in Lanji, which is less than 5 kms away from Sinapali.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in S. Cheragaon, which is less than 5 kms away from Sinapali.
